CS 714 - Clinical Nutrition

Credits: (3)
The clinical aspects of nutrition as it relates to (a) medical and surgical management of diseased and convalescent animals (therapeutic nutrition), and (b) programs of disease prevention of the common domestic species of food-producing, companion animals, pet birds, and exotic animals (nutritional preventative medicine).

Requisites
Prerequisite: Third-year standing in the College of Veterinary Medicine.

When Offered
Spring

Cross-listed
ASI 886 and AP 886

UGE course
No
